Parts and Names

This section gives the names of the parts of the EtherNet/IP Coupler Unit, NX Units, and End Plates
and describes the functions of the parts.
4-1-1

EtherNet/IP Coupler Units

This section gives the names of the parts of the EtherNet/IP Coupler Unit.

The locations where markers are attached. The markers made by
OMRON are installed for the factory setting. Commercially available
markers can also be installed.
For details, refer to 6-1-8 Attaching Markers on page 6-18.
The specifications of the Unit are engraved in the side of the casing.
This connector is used to connect the EtherNet/IP Coupler Unit to the
NX Unit on the right of the Coupler Unit.
These hooks are used to mount the EtherNet/IP Coupler Unit to a DIN
Track.
The protrusions to hold when removing the Unit.
These guides are used to connect two Units.
The indicators show the current operating status of the Unit and the
status of the power supply.
This port is used to connect to the Support Software.
The terminal block is used to connect to the power supply cables and
ground wire.
This plate is connected internally to the functional ground terminal on
the terminal block.
The DIP switch is used to set the default node address of the Ether-
Net/IP Coupler Unit as an EtherNet/IP slave.
These connectors are connected to the communications cables of the
EtherNet/IP network.
The rotary switches are used to set the last octet of the IP address of
the EtherNet/IP Coupler Unit as an EtherNet/IP Slave. The address is
set in hexadecimal.
